Lee is comparing brands of juice. Brand A

<h3>Answer: 3 bottles of brand A</h3>

Explanation:

The pricing/cost information is not used in this problem. All we care about is the number of bottles, and how much each bottle can hold.

Brand A bottles hold 0.95 liters each. We bought 3 of these bottles, so 3*0.95 = 2.85 liters in total are purchased.

Brand B bottles hold 0.55 liters each. Buying 5 of them leads to 5*0.55 = 2.75 liters in total.

Going with the brand A option leads to more juice by 0.10 liters (subtract 2.85 and 2.75)
